Folio(s): 555-556.
Name: M A Smithersman.
Rank: [unspecified].
Unit/Battalion/Regiment: Queen Mary's Army Auxiliary Corps, 65 Holland Park.
Service number: 34107.
Age: 18.
Hospital(s): Queen Mary's Army Auxiliary Corps Sick Hostel, 53 Holland Park, London.
Condition/Injury/Disease: Influenza.
Details and Outcome: Patient admitted suffering with influenza. No further details given. Discharged from hospital 18 July 1918. Includes a clinical chart and a diet sheet.
Number of Pages: 2.
